Raja quits, at long last
New Delhi, Nov. 14: Named in the Rs 1,76,000 crore scam, the embattled telecom minister, A. Raja, resigned on Sunday night.
Mr Raja flew from Chennai to New Delhi and drove straight to the house of the Prime Minister, Dr Manmohan Singh, and submitted his resignation.
“In order to avoid embarrassment to the government and maintain peace and harmony in Parliament, my leader (DMK chief M. Karunanidhi) has advised me to resign,” Mr Raja told PTI.
